最近2018中文字幕在日韩欧美国产成人片_国产日韩精品一区二区在线_在线观看成年美女黄网色视频_国产精品一区三区五区_国产精彩刺激乱对白_看黄色黄大色黄片免费_人人超碰自拍cao_国产高清av在线_亚洲精品电影av_日韩美女尤物视频网站

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
Java隨機生成的代碼是 java隨機生成的代碼是什么

java如何產(chǎn)生1-10隨機數(shù)

java代碼方法一如下:

10多年的霍爾果斯網(wǎng)站建設(shè)經(jīng)驗,針對設(shè)計、前端、開發(fā)、售后、文案、推廣等六對一服務(wù),響應(yīng)快,48小時及時工作處理。營銷型網(wǎng)站建設(shè)的優(yōu)勢是能夠根據(jù)用戶設(shè)備顯示端的尺寸不同,自動調(diào)整霍爾果斯建站的顯示方式,使網(wǎng)站能夠適用不同顯示終端,在瀏覽器中調(diào)整網(wǎng)站的寬度,無論在任何一種瀏覽器上瀏覽網(wǎng)站,都能展現(xiàn)優(yōu)雅布局與設(shè)計,從而大程度地提升瀏覽體驗。創(chuàng)新互聯(lián)從事“霍爾果斯網(wǎng)站設(shè)計”,“霍爾果斯網(wǎng)站推廣”以來,每個客戶項目都認(rèn)真落實執(zhí)行。

int random=(int)(Math.random()*10+1)

java代碼方法二如下:

package bdqn_Empy;

import java.util.Random;

public class Text {

/**

* @param args

*/

public static void main(String[] args) {

// TODO Auto-generated method stub

int a=0;

Random b=new Random();

a=b.nextInt(101);

System.out.println(a);

}

}

擴展資料:

可以先通過 random方法生成一個隨機數(shù),然后將結(jié)果乘以10。此時產(chǎn)生的隨機數(shù)字即為大于等于0小于10的數(shù)字。

然后再利用nt方法進行轉(zhuǎn)換它會去掉小數(shù)掉后面的數(shù)字即只獲取整數(shù)部分,不是四舍五入)。最后即可獲取一個0到9的整數(shù)型隨機數(shù)字。其實現(xiàn)方法很簡單,就是對原有的 grandom方法按照如下的格式進行變型:(int( Math. Random0*10)即可。

其實我們還可以對這個方法進行擴展,讓其產(chǎn)生任意范圍內(nèi)的隨機數(shù)。至需要將這個10換成n即可,如改為( int(Math. Random0n)。此時應(yīng)用程序就會產(chǎn)生一個大于等于0小與n之間的隨機數(shù)。

如將n設(shè)置為5,那么其就會產(chǎn)生一個0到5之間的整數(shù)型的隨機數(shù)。如果將這個寫成一個帶參數(shù)的方法,那么只要用戶輸入需要生成隨機數(shù)的最大值,就可以讓這個方法來生成制定范圍的隨機數(shù)。

請java中的解釋一段隨機生成字母+數(shù)字的代碼

就是把隨機產(chǎn)生的int轉(zhuǎn)成大小寫字母和數(shù)字對應(yīng)的ascii碼,因為大,小寫字母和數(shù)字的ascii碼不是連續(xù)的,所以要分別考慮。 asc('0') = 48, asc('A') = 65, asc('a') = 97

java隨機生成請幫忙改下代碼

你的Java生成隨機數(shù)的程序,我?guī)湍愀暮昧?你看看吧.

完整的Java生成隨機數(shù)程序如下

public?class?C?{

public?static?void?main(String?[]args)?{

show();

}

public?static?void?show()?{

int?n?=?3;

char?a?;

char?A?;

char?o?;

for?(int?i?=?0;?i??n;?i++)?{

a?=?(char)?(Math.random()?*?26?+?'a');

A?=?(char)?(Math.random()?*?26?+?'A');

o?=?(char)?(Math.random()?*?10?+?'0');

System.out.println(""?+?a?+?A?+?o);

}

}?

}

運行結(jié)果

yD9

sE1

cD6

如何用java隨機生成一個字母

char c=(char)(int)(Math.random()*26+97);

System.out.println(c);

通過隨機函數(shù)生成,字母對應(yīng)的int整型數(shù)字,然后轉(zhuǎn)換才char類型的字母。

tring chars = "abcdefghijklmnopqrstuvwxyz";

System.out.println(chars.charAt((int)(Math.random() * 26)));

根據(jù)chars 隨機截取其中的一個字母。

擴展資料:

定義隨機字母之前調(diào)用

import java.util.Arrays;

產(chǎn)生隨機數(shù)的代碼為:

char cha[]={'A','B','C','D','E','F','G','H','I','J','K','L','M','N','O','P','Q','R','S','T','U','V','W','X','Y','Z'};

char ch[]=new char[5];

for(int i=0;ich.length;i++)

{

int index;

index=(int)(Math.random()*(cha.length));

ch[i]=cha[index];

}

System.out.println(Arrays.toString(ch));

這個是產(chǎn)生5個隨機字母在A-Z的范圍

請問java中如何生成1000~10000之間的隨機數(shù)?

要生成在[min,max]之間的隨機整數(shù),可使用Random類進行相關(guān)運算,代碼如下:

import java.util.Random;

public class RandomTest {

public static void main(String[] args) {

int max=10000;

int min=1000;

Random random = new Random();

int s = random.nextInt(max)%(max-min+1) + min;

System.out.println(s);

}

}

random.nextInt(max)表示生成[0,max]之間的隨機數(shù),然后對(max-min+1)取模。

以生成[1000,10000]隨機數(shù)為例,首先生成0-10000的隨機數(shù),然后對(10000-1000+1)取模得到[0-1000]之間的隨機數(shù),然后加上min=1000,最后生成的是1000-10000的隨機數(shù)


分享名稱:Java隨機生成的代碼是 java隨機生成的代碼是什么
標(biāo)題路徑:http://fisionsoft.com.cn/article/doddiej.html